  • Pull thermal management updates from Zhang Rui:
    "This time, the biggest change is the work of representing hardware
    thermal properties in device tree infrastructure.

    This work includes the introduction of a device tree bindings for
    describing the hardware thermal behavior and limits, and also a parser
    to read and interpret the data, and build thermal zones and thermal
    binding parameters. It also contains three examples on how to use the
    new representation on sensor devices, using three different drivers to
    accomplish it. One driver is in thermal subsystem, the TI SoC
    thermal, and the other two drivers are in hwmon subsystem.

    Actually, this would be the first step of the complete work because we
    still need to check other potential drivers to be converted and then
    validate the proposed API. But the reason why I include it in this
    pull request is that, first, this change does not hurt any others
    without using this approach, second, the principle and concept of this
    change would not break after converting the remaining drivers. BTW,
    as you can see, there are several points in this change that do not
    belong to thermal subsystem. Because it has been suggested by Guenter
    R that in such cases, it is recommended to send the complete series
    via one single subsystem.

    Specifics:

    - representing hardware thermal properties in device tree
    infrastructure

    - fix a regression that the imx thermal driver breaks system suspend.

    - introduce ACPI INT3403 thermal driver to retrieve temperature data
    from the INT3403 ACPI device object present on some systems.

    - introduce debug statement for thermal core and step_wise governor.

    - assorted fixes and cleanups for thermal core, cpu cooling, exynos
    thrmal, intel powerclamp and imx thermal driver"

  • Pull ACPI and power management updates from Rafael Wysocki:
    "As far as the number of commits goes, the top spot belongs to ACPI
    this time with cpufreq in the second position and a handful of PM
    core, PNP and cpuidle updates. They are fixes and cleanups mostly, as
    usual, with a couple of new features in the mix.

    The most visible change is probably that we will create struct
    acpi_device objects (visible in sysfs) for all devices represented in
    the ACPI tables regardless of their status and there will be a new
    sysfs attribute under those objects allowing user space to check that
    status via _STA.

    Consequently, ACPI device eject or generally hot-removal will not
    delete those objects, unless the table containing the corresponding
    namespace nodes is unloaded, which is extremely rare. Also ACPI
    container hotplug will be handled quite a bit differently and cpufreq
    will support CPU boost ("turbo") generically and not only in the
    acpi-cpufreq driver.

    Specifics:

    - ACPI core changes to make it create a struct acpi_device object for
    every device represented in the ACPI tables during all namespace
    scans regardless of the current status of that device. In
    accordance with this, ACPI hotplug operations will not delete those
    objects, unless the underlying ACPI tables go away.

    - On top of the above, new sysfs attribute for ACPI device objects
    allowing user space to check device status by triggering the
    execution of _STA for its ACPI object. From Srinivas Pandruvada.

    - ACPI core hotplug changes reducing code duplication, integrating
    the PCI root hotplug with the core and reworking container hotplug.

    - ACPI core simplifications making it use ACPI_COMPANION() in the
    code "glueing" ACPI device objects to "physical" devices.

    - ACPICA update to upstream version 20131218. This adds support for
    the DBG2 and PCCT tables to ACPICA, fixes some bugs and improves
    debug facilities. From Bob Moore, Lv Zheng and Betty Dall.

    - Init code change to carry out the early ACPI initialization
    earlier. That should allow us to use ACPI during the timekeeping
    initialization and possibly to simplify the EFI initialization too.
    From Chun-Yi Lee.

    - Clenups of the inclusions of ACPI headers in many places all over
    from Lv Zheng and Rashika Kheria (work in progress).

    - New helper for ACPI _DSM execution and rework of the code in
    drivers that uses _DSM to execute it via the new helper. From
    Jiang Liu.

    - New Win8 OSI blacklist entries from Takashi Iwai.

    - Assorted ACPI fixes and cleanups from Al Stone, Emil Goode, Hanjun
    Guo, Lan Tianyu, Masanari Iida, Oliver Neukum, Prarit Bhargava,
    Rashika Kheria, Tang Chen, Zhang Rui.

    - intel_pstate driver updates, including proper Baytrail support,
    from Dirk Brandewie and intel_pstate documentation from Ramkumar
    Ramachandra.

    - Generic CPU boost ("turbo") support for cpufreq from Lukasz
    Majewski.

    - powernow-k6 cpufreq driver fixes from Mikulas Patocka.

    - cpufreq core fixes and cleanups from Viresh Kumar, Jane Li, Mark
    Brown.

    - Assorted cpufreq drivers fixes and cleanups from Anson Huang, John
    Tobias, Paul Bolle, Paul Walmsley, Sachin Kamat, Shawn Guo, Viresh
    Kumar.

    - cpuidle cleanups from Bartlomiej Zolnierkiewicz.

    - Support for hibernation APM events from Bin Shi.

    - Hibernation fix to avoid bringing up nonboot CPUs with ACPI EC
    disabled during thaw transitions from Bjørn Mork.

    - PM core fixes and cleanups from Ben Dooks, Leonardo Potenza, Ulf
    Hansson.

    - PNP subsystem fixes and cleanups from Dmitry Torokhov, Levente
    Kurusa, Rashika Kheria.

    - New tool for profiling system suspend from Todd E Brandt and a
    cpupower tool cleanup from One Thousand Gnomes"

  • Pull Xen updates from Konrad Rzeszutek Wilk:
    "Two major features that Xen community is excited about:

    The first is event channel scalability by David Vrabel - we switch
    over from an two-level per-cpu bitmap of events (IRQs) - to an FIFO
    queue with priorities. This lets us be able to handle more events,
    have lower latency, and better scalability. Good stuff.

    The other is PVH by Mukesh Rathor. In short, PV is a mode where the
    kernel lets the hypervisor program page-tables, segments, etc. With
    EPT/NPT capabilities in current processors, the overhead of doing this
    in an HVM (Hardware Virtual Machine) container is much lower than the
    hypervisor doing it for us.

    In short we let a PV guest run without doing page-table, segment,
    syscall, etc updates through the hypervisor - instead it is all done
    within the guest container. It is a "hybrid" PV - hence the 'PVH'
    name - a PV guest within an HVM container.

    The major benefits are less code to deal with - for example we only
    use one function from the the pv_mmu_ops (which has 39 function
    calls); faster performance for syscall (no context switches into the
    hypervisor); less traps on various operations; etc.

    It is still being baked - the ABI is not yet set in stone. But it is
    pretty awesome and we are excited about it.

    Lastly, there are some changes to ARM code - you should get a simple
    conflict which has been resolved in #linux-next.

    In short, this pull has awesome features.

    Features:
    - FIFO event channels. Key advantages: support for over 100,000
    events (2^17), 16 different event priorities, improved fairness in
    event latency through the use of FIFOs.
    - Xen PVH support. "It’s a fully PV kernel mode, running with
    paravirtualized disk and network, paravirtualized interrupts and
    timers, no emulated devices of any kind (and thus no qemu), no BIOS
    or legacy boot — but instead of requiring PV MMU, it uses the HVM
    hardware extensions to virtualize the pagetables, as well as system
    calls and other privileged operations." (from "The
    Paravirtualization Spectrum, Part 2: From poles to a spectrum")

    Bug-fixes:
    - Fixes in balloon driver (refactor and make it work under ARM)
    - Allow xenfb to be used in HVM guests.
    - Allow xen_platform_pci=0 to work properly.
    - Refactors in event channels"

  • A couple of years ago all the "L: lkml" email list entries in
    MAINTAINERS were removed and replaced with a 'the rest' entry
    at the end of the file - under the theory that this is unnecessary
    duplication and that people would find it intuitive:

    b5472cddbe2c MAINTAINERS: remove L: linux-kernel@vger.kernel.org from all but "THE REST"

    So it turns out that it's all but intuitive, not all people
    use scripts/get_maintainer.pl to extract maintainer contact info,
    some people read the MAINTAINERS file and see the lack of 'L:' entries
    of various lkml-only subsystems and are sending patches to the
    maintainers only, without Cc:-ing lkml. They arguably have a point.

    In hindsight removing all the "L: lkml" entries was probably not
    an overly good idea, not all mechanic duplication should be eliminated:
    in files read by humans it's useful to have 'at a glance' summary for
    all email addresses important to a subsystem's maintenance, in a single
    place, without too many imported rules and assumptions.

    So, to make the lkml fallback really apparent, add back 'L: lkml'
    entries to all subsystem entries whose workflow I'm involved in.
    This should at minimum be a per subsystem policy thing.
